INTERPROVINCIAL NEWS.
PBB UNITED PBESS ASSOCIATION. Chbistchubch, This Day. Thomas Robertson, traveller for Mason and Struthers, was to-day committed for trial on charges of embezzling £28, and stealing saddlery valued at £18. Wellington. This Day. The Medical attendants of Mr Wood, M.L.C., report that he is no better, and, doubts are entertained as to bis recovery. An extraordinary Gazette issued last night contains the resignation of the Stout- Vogel Ministry and the appoint, ment of the Atkinson Ministry. '■' Napieb, This Day. Dr Jackson and the Other attendants at the quarantine station were admitted to pratique yesterday. They are in excellent health. "
